| Background | Bra4F1 reacts with CD15 (220 kDa). CD15 is present on >95% of granulocytes including neutrophils and eosinophils and to a lesser degree on monocytes. CD15 is further expressed in Reed-Sternberg cells in classic Hodgkin s disease. CD15 is occasionally expressed in large cell lymphomas of both B and T phenotypes. It is also expressed on a wide variety of other tumor cells including myeloid leukemia, breast, colorectal, and lung cancer cells. Bra4F1 was clustered at the IVth International Workshop on Leucocyte Differentiation Antigens. |
